盾构隧道装配式管片接头三维有限元分析

摘    要:根据Saenz公式将混凝土本构模型简化为双折线线性强化弹塑性模型,推导了混凝土弹塑性参数的计算公式.应用大型结构分析有限元软件Alogr对装配式管片接头进行三维线弹性和弹塑性有限元分析,得到了混凝土应变、接头位移、接缝转角、螺栓拉力等计算结果,并将有限元计算结果与接头荷载试验测试结果进行了对比.研究表明,有限元计算值与试验值两者的变化规律是一致的,计算结果在反映结构应力/应变分布规律方面有重要参考作用.

3-D FEM Analysis on Prefabricated Segment Joints of Shield Tunnel

Abstract:The double lines strengthening elastic plastic model was developed by simplifying the concrete constitutive law according to Saenz formula. The formulae for the model parameters were given. The structural analysis procedure Algor was taken to conduct the linear elastic and elastic plastic FEM analysis on the joints of segments. The strain distribution of segment, the displacement of joints, the rotary angle of joints and the tensile force of joint bolts were given. The comparison between FEM calculation and test results was made, which shows that the finite element analysis results correspond with the test results. The FEM analysis results can be an effective measure to observe the distribution patterns of the strain and stress.
